3 Steering problem

Failure Date: 11/25/2008

Backed out of garage on cold morning and couldn't turn steering wheel (especially to the left) until several minutes of idling and forcing to extreme right and then to left, several times, problem is getting worse and even after driving several miles, it has hung up on left turns requiring a slight right turn and janking to left in cold temperatures.

5 Steering problem

Failure Date: 11/06/2007

I have had 2 recalls taken care of however the steering in my 2002 Caravan still continues to lock up when making turns. This has caused me to almost have more than one collision because this can happen when pulling out in traffic and turning. I am a busy mother with four children who depend on me for their safety. Today my son who is in college borrowed my van to go to school and almost had an accident. This is why I am doing research on this problem. If you force the steering it will finally break away and continue to steer however you do not know when to expect it to be defective. I thought when I took care of the recalls that this would fix the problem however, we still have to battle with this problem on a regular basis. Most of the time it happens when the weather turns colder. I have not been informed of any new recalls on my vehicle. We keep a regular check on the fluids so I know this is not the problem.
